WebMay 7, 2015 · Since you have three 2p-orbitals in the 2p-subshell, the maximum number of electrons the 2p-subshell can hold is 6. The 2s-subshell, on the other hand, only contains one orbital, the 2s-orbital, so you can say that the 2s-orbital is also the 2s-subshell, and vice versa. Answer link WebJul 14, 2024 · The first principal energy level has one sublevel that contains one orbital, called the s orbital. The s orbital can contain a maximum of two electrons. The next principal energy level contains one s orbital and three p orbitals. The set of three p orbitals can hold up to six electrons.
